vue封装element组件详解?
首先,利用vue官方提供的cli(3.x)生成一个Vue工程,具体的cli安装和生成工程的过程可以参考官网Vue CLI的章节。看下生成的vue工程结构,
可以看到工程中有个App.vue,这是整个工程最顶端的组件,之后所有新开发的组件都是嵌套在这个组件中。
从App.vue中可以看出,组件分为三个部分
1. template : 这是html部分,负责组件的展示
2. script : 这是js部分,负责组件的逻辑
3. style : 这是css部分,负责组件的渲染
一般所有的组件都带有这三部分
h5怎么让组件移动?
您好,要让H5页面中的组件移动,可以使用CSS3的动画效果或JavaScript的动态操作。
使用CSS3动画:
1. 首先需要给要移动的组件添加CSS样式,比如给一个图片添加如下样式:
```
img{
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%,-50%);
}
```
2. 然后使用CSS3的动画效果,比如让图片向右移动100px:
```
img{
animation: moveRight 2s forwards;
}
@keyframes moveRight{
0%{
left: 50%;
}
100%{
left: calc(50% + 100px);
}
}
```
使用JavaScript动态操作:
1. 首先需要获取要移动的组件,比如获取一个图片:
```
var img = document.querySelector('img');
```
2. 然后使用JavaScript的动态操作,比如让图片向右移动100px:
```
var left = parseInt(img.style.left) || 0;
img.style.left = left + 100 + 'px';
```
需要注意的是,使用JavaScript动态操作时需要考虑兼容性问题,比如使用兼容性较好的transform属性来实现移动。
你好,要让h5中的组件移动,需要以下三个步骤:
1. 给组件添加手势:在组件上添加touchstart、touchmove、touchend等各种手势事件。这可以通过javascript代码或第三方库实现。
2. 监听手势事件:在手势事件中获取组件当前的位置,以及计算出手指在屏幕上移动的距离。这样就可以在组件上实现拖动等操作。
3. 通过js代码设置组件位置:在手势事件中计算出组件移动后的位置,通过js代码修改组件的left和top值,来实现组件的移动。
以上是简单的移动组件方式,实际上还有更多细节需要考虑。
html文本属性有哪些?
HTML的全称为超文本标记语言,是一种标记语言。它包括一系列标签.通过这些标签可以将网络上的文档格式统一,使分散的Internet资源连接为一个逻辑整体。HTML文本是由HTML命令组成的描述性文本,HTML命令可以说明文字,图形、动画、声音、表格、链接等。[1]
超文本是一种组织信息的方式,它通过超级链接方法将文本中的文字、图表与其他信息媒体相关联。这些相互关联的信息媒体可能在同一文本中,也可能是其他文件,或是地理位置相距遥远的某台计算机上的文件。这种组织信息方式将分布在不同位置的信息资源用随机方式进行连接,为人们查找,检索信息提供方便。